Nestled in the serene surroundings of Llannerch Hall, Llannerch Park, this beautifully converted three-bedroom detached barn (circa 1860) offers the perfect blend of character and modern living. Thoughtfully modernised throughout, the property provides a peaceful retreat while remaining close to local amenities.
Inside, a spacious lounge leads to an open-plan kitchen and dining area with oak worktops, fitted units, and integrated appliances, including a five-ring Belling oven and hob. The ground floor bedroom with en suite adds flexibility, while upstairs features a master bedroom with en suite toilet, a second double bedroom, and a family bathroom.
Outside, a private rear patio garden with summer house, double gated parking access, and stone and brick boundary walls complete this delightful home.
Additional features include underfloor heating, modern décor throughout, and no onward chain.
A rare opportunity to own a stunning 19th-century barn conversion in one of St Asaph’s most picturesque and peaceful settings.
